SATURDAY'S GAME BASICS
At the midway point of conference play, Oklahoma (8-13, 2-7 Big 12) begins its second round of competition against its nine Big 12 opponents. First up for the Sooners is a Saturday evening contest with Texas Tech (15-7, 3-6 Big 12) in Lubbock, Texas. Oklahoma defeated the Red Raiders, 84-75, in the first meeting last month and looks to sweep Tech for the third time in the Lon Kruger era.

FIVE THINGS TO KNOW
•A pair of rookie Sooners enter their first game of February coming off of an excellent January. Freshmen Kameron McGusty and Kristian Doolittle combined to average 27.1 points per game in the month of January, almost doubling their scoring output from the first month of the season (15.0 points per game in November).

• In his most recent outing, McGusty scored a career-high 22 points against Oklahoma State (Jan. 30). McGusty has totaled 20 points on three occasions this season – all within the past seven games. His three 20-point games are the most by an OU freshman since Jordan Woodard (also had three) in 2013-14. McGusty ranks second among all Big 12 freshmen in scoring during conference play with 15.8 points.

• McGusty enters Saturday with nine-straight games of scoring in double-figures. Should he score 10 or more points against the Red Raiders, McGusty will be the first Sooner freshman to string together 10 consecutive games of at least 10 points since Jeff Webster achieved a 22-game streak in 1990-91. Blake Griffin is the only other Sooner freshman in the past 25 years to reach nine-straight games.

• Junior forward Khadeem Lattin recorded a season-high six blocked shots against Oklahoma State on Monday. Lattin leads the Big 12 in blocked shots during conference play, registering 2.8 rejections per game (2.2 on the season). The junior averages 2.8 blocks per game against the Red Raiders in five previous meetings, including a career-high eight swats on Jan. 26, 2016.

• Oklahoma won the first meeting with Tech this season on Jan. 14, 84-75, at Lloyd Noble Center. The Sooners were boosted by a pair of 20-point performances from senior guard Jordan Woodard (27 points) and sophomore guard Rashard Odomes (24 points). Odomes shot 9-of-14 from the field en route to his career-high 24 points. The sophomore notched 17 points on 7-of-8 shooting in the opening half and rounded out his evening with eight rebounds and four assists in 35 minutes.

SERIES HISTORY
• Oklahoma owns a 38-22 lead in the all-time series. The Sooners have won seven of the last nine meetings, including an 84-75 victory earlier this season in Norman.

• Tech holds a 14-13 advantage when playing in Lubbock. Should the Sooners win, Lubbock would be the fourth Big 12 city that the Sooners hold a .500 record or better in - joining Fort Worth, Morgantown and Waco.

• The Sooners are 8-3 against Tech in the Lon Kruger era and hold a 3-2 record in Lubbock under Kruger.
